In the seventh of our 2015 GNAC Football Video Previews, we feature Azusa Pacific.

Azusa Pacific is picked to win their third consecutive GNAC title in four years as a conference member. They also enter the season ranked No. 19 in the American Football Coaches Association Division II Preseason Poll. The Cougars ended the 2014 season ranked 23rd after spending much of the season ranked in the lower half of the top-25. They are also ranked No. 23 in the D2Football.com Preseason Poll.

The Cougars thrived as a running team last year, leading the GNAC and 10th in Division II with 269.3 rushing yards per game. All-American running back Terrell Watson led the charge as he led Division II in rushing touchdowns (29), rushing yards (2,253), rushing yards per game (195.7) and scoring (15.8 points per game). The Cougars finished in top-50 in 23 different Division II statistical categories, including second in turnovers lost (10), third in sacks (3.91 per game), sixth in turnover margin (1.36) and seventh in passes had intercepted (5).

The Cougars return 38 letterwinners, but will be looking to replace a number of key role players including Watson, First Team All-GNAC offensive lineman Cody Clay and first team defensive standouts Steven Fanua and Tyler Thornton. The team returns a pair of First Team All-GNAC selections in tight end Grant Widmer and defensive lineman David Kofovalu and a trio of second teamers in offensive linemen Jaylen Crutchfield and Ahmad Sunda and defensive back CJ Broussard.
